The Office BOSS
PH: 530-587-1620
Address:12177 Business Park Dr Ste 2
Truckee, CA 96161-3342
Fax:530-587-6228
Store Hours
-
Open
Close
-
Sat
May 17
Closed
Today
-
Sun
May 18
Closed
-
Mon
May 19
8:30AM
5:00PM
-
Tue
May 20
8:30AM
5:00PM
-
Wed
May 21
8:30AM
5:00PM
-
Thu
May 22
8:30AM
5:00PM
-
Fri
May 23
8:30AM
5:00PM